Man sentenced 12-25 years for killing friend in Ann Arbor during road trip
ANN ARBOR, MI – What should have been a road trip to see a friend ended in two families losing loved ones. Washtenaw County Trial Judge Carol Kuhnke sentenced Johnson Tuesday, March 8 to serve 12-25 years for killing Littleton who was fatally shot in the head by Johnson outside an Ann Arbor hotel. Johnson, 22, pleaded guilty Feb. 8 to one count of second-degree murder for the shooting death of his friend Littleton, 31.
